FanDuel DFS Point Guards

Kemba Walker (at LAL, $8,600)

Certainly there is the possibility that Steph Curry sizzles in front of the New York crowd, but he is really going to cost you if you choose to roster the Baby Faced Assassin. Instead, you can save a little fake money by drafting Walker. Despite going an atrocious 12-for-50 from the field over his last two, Walker has been aggressive in getting to the free throw line. He has taken at least 25 shots in four of his last five games and that sort of ball-hawking usually gets rewarded in the DFS world. He should have no problem slicing up the Lakers and their fifth-worst shooting percentage defense

Deron Williams (vs PHX, $5,500)

After his dud performance against the Knicks on Thursday, the how to beat Archie Goodwin playbook is an open secret. As long as point guards play fast and attack the rim, the third-year veteran out of Kentucky will attempt to match basket for basket and get run out of his element relatively quickly. Williams is the type of guard that can really attack Goodwin and his 109 DRating. Throw his last game out. He was shooting nearly 47% from the field in his previous three, and it also appears his injury woes are a thing of the past.

 

FanDuel DFS Shooting Guards

Dwyane Wade (vs ATL, $7,800)

Turn back the clock! Flash has indeed shown flashes of dominance that he displayed in the pre-LeBron years. The 34-year-old All Star is averaging 43.2 FanDuel points per game over his last four, playing no less than 32 minutes during that span. With the less than inspiring play being displayed by both Tyler Johnson and Beno Udrih as well, Wade is racking up the assists and playing some point guard. Goran Dragic should be on a minutes restriction if he plays, freeing up Wade to be the only reliable backcourt option for the Heat.

Klay Thompson (at NY, $7,000)

It appears Mr. Thompson is in the middle of one of his patented hot streaks. He has gone 11-for-22 from behind the arc over his last two games, and Thompson typically is a guy that plays in three to four game bursts. The Warriors are massive favorites, but the starters have been getting their minutes in blowouts.

 

FanDuel DFS Small Forwards

Chandler Parsons (vs PHX, $6,700)

I am not quite ready to reinvest in Carmelo Anthony, but I certainly understand if some fantasy owners want to roster the budding Knick superstar. Instead, I will opt to free up some cap room and roster Parsons, a guy that has been as close to white hot as possible over the last eleven days. Since January 20, Parsons is averaging 24.3 points, 7.5 boards, 2.7 assists, and 0.7 steals in six games. He should have no problem carving up the league’s 26th ranked defensive unit.

Evan Turner (at ORL, $5,300)

Turner has scored double-digit points in six straight games and he is always a guy that will add some extra stats across the line. His minutes appears locked in right now in that crazy Celtic rotation, so he should continue to consistently contribute anywhere from 28-32 FanDuel points. Meanwhile, the Magic are in complete freefall mode and there are no signs of slowing anyone down. Should Boston win in a blowout, Turner is safe to get some extra run in garbage time.

 

FanDuel DFS Power Forwards

Chris Bosh (at ATL, $7,700)

Most of the other options at this position have some questions, and Bosh is not without his. Primarily will Hassan Whiteside play? Of course that is also a Whiteside question, but if the giant center does miss his fifth straight game, then Bosh becomes the primary interior threat for the Heat. Post-LeBron Bosh continues to thrive with his usage rate this season and January has been an exceptional month for the big man. You would like to see him secure more rebounds, but he has a nice stat line of 22.0/5.7/2.8 over his last six games.

Marvin Williams (at LAL, $5,400)

All season the Hornets have been waiting for the former Tar Heel to break out, and now their patience is finally paying off. Of course it has taken injuries to Cody Zeller and Al Jefferson, but fantasy owners are quite happy with his recent production. Those injuries have really opened the door for Williams, who owns a 115 ORating while averaging 28.8 minutes per game in the month of January. Those are some nice baselines to start with against a team like the Lakers. Arrow up.

 

FanDuel DFS Centers

Karl-Anthony Towns (at POR, $8,400)

Dude has dropped 47.2, 46.1 and 46.9 FanDuel points in three straight games against Cleveland, Oklahoma City and Utah, respectively. He is so studly that this is the only downside FanDuel could find on the big man: “more assists could help his fantasy value and his team’s play.” Wow. I’ll take his 23/12.5 he is averaging over his last six against whatever Portland is putting up in the front court.
